Debugging Large Frame Size Issues

August 4, 2025 ยท View on GitHub

Problem

When you encounter the error "The frame is bigger than expected. Length: 808922930, max: 1048576", it indicates that iOS devices are sending data packets larger than the default buffer limits.

Investigation Steps

1. Enable Debug Logging

Set these environment variables to investigate the issue:

export APPIUM_IOS_DEBUG_FRAME_SIZE=true
export APPIUM_IOS_LOG_LARGE_FRAMES=true
export APPIUM_IOS_MONITOR_MEMORY=true
export APPIUM_IOS_LARGE_FRAME_THRESHOLD=10485760  # 10MB threshold

2. Run Your Tests

With debug logging enabled, run your Appium tests. The enhanced logging will show:

  • Which service is causing the large frame (WebInspector, AFC, etc.)
  • Exact frame sizes being received
  • Memory usage at the time of the issue
  • Detailed error information

3. Analyze the Logs

Look for these log messages:

Large frame detected: 771.45 MB
Service: WebInspector, Max allowed: 1.00 MB
Memory usage - RSS: 245.67 MB, Heap: 123.45 MB

4. Identify the Root Cause

Based on the service name and frame size, determine:

  • WebInspector: Usually indicates large JavaScript debugging data
  • AFC: File transfer operations with large files
  • USBMUX: Device communication issues
  • Plist Service: Large property list data

Common Causes

WebInspector Large Frames

  • Cause: JavaScript debugging data, DOM snapshots, or performance profiles
  • Solution: Consider disabling detailed debugging or using streaming

AFC Large Frames

  • Cause: Large file transfers (logs, screenshots, app bundles)
  • Solution: Implement chunked file transfers

Memory Issues

  • Cause: Multiple parallel test sessions consuming too much memory
  • Solution: Reduce parallel sessions or implement memory cleanup

Temporary Workarounds

# Set environment variable to increase frame size limit
export APPIUM_IOS_MAX_FRAME_SIZE=1073741824  # 1GB in bytes

# Or use human-readable values
export APPIUM_IOS_MAX_FRAME_SIZE=104857600   # 100MB
export APPIUM_IOS_MAX_FRAME_SIZE=524288000   # 500MB

Note: This approach is preferred over code changes as it doesn't require recompilation and can be easily adjusted per environment.

Reporting Issues

When reporting this issue, include:

  1. Debug logs with environment variables enabled
  2. Service name causing the issue
  3. Frame size and memory usage
  4. iOS device version and model
  5. Appium version and driver version
  6. Test scenario that triggers the issue

Example Debug Output

[debug] Frame size detected: 1.00 MB, max allowed: 1.00 MB
[warn] Large frame detected: 771.45 MB
[warn] Service: WebInspector, Max allowed: 1.00 MB
[warn] Memory usage - RSS: 245.67 MB, Heap: 123.45 MB
[error] The frame is bigger than expected. Length: 771.45 MB, max: 1.00 MB
[error] Service: WebInspector, Frame offset: 0, Frame length: 4
[error] To debug this issue, set environment variables:
[error]   APPIUM_IOS_DEBUG_FRAME_SIZE=true
[error]   APPIUM_IOS_LOG_LARGE_FRAMES=true
[error]   APPIUM_IOS_MONITOR_MEMORY=true
